hdu2023 求平均成绩 ~~很闲~~~

 #include<iostream>
#include<stdio.h>
#include<math.h>
#include<string.h>
#include<stdlib.h>
#include<limits>
using namespace std;
int map[][];
int main()
{
int n,m;
while(~scanf("%d%d",&n,&m))
{
double sum=;
memset(map,,sizeof(map));
for(int i=;i<n;i++)
for(int j=;j<m;j++)
scanf("%d",&map[i][j]); for(int i=;i<n;i++)
{
sum=;
for(int j=;j<m;j++)
{
sum+=map[i][j];
}
sum=sum/m;
if(i==)
printf("%.2lf",sum);
else
printf(" %.2lf",sum);
}
cout<<endl;
double aver[];
int t=;
memset(aver,,sizeof(aver));
for(int j=;j<m;j++)
{
sum=;
for(int i=;i<n;i++)
sum+=map[i][j];
sum=sum/n;
aver[t++]=sum;
if(j==)
printf("%.2lf",sum);
else
printf(" %.2lf",sum);
}
cout<<endl;
// for(int i=0;i<t;i++)
// printf("%lf ",aver[i]);
int flag=;
int num=;
for(int i=;i<n;i++)
{
for(int j=;j<m;j++)
{
if(map[i][j]<aver[j])
flag=;
}
if(flag==)
{
flag=;
continue;
}
else
num++;
}
printf("%d\n\n",num);
}
return ;
}
上一篇:測試大型資料表的 Horizontal Partitioning 水平切割


下一篇:Mongodb使用